The Upstream Version Freeze for Ubuntu 6.04 (Dapper) begins today,
2005-01-19.  This first phase of our progressive freeze means that no new
upstream versions of packages should be uploaded without prior approval, and
automatic package syncs from Debian will be disabled.

Manual syncs from Debian (where they do not involve new upstream releases)
may still be requested by the usual means, and exceptions for new upstream
versions should be submitted to myself or Colin Watson
<cjwatson@ubuntu.com>.
